I want read blob image using cv or PIL. here is my backend code diversity energy solutions ltdWebJan 10, 2024 · A BLOB is a binary large object that can hold a variable amount of data. We can represent the files in binary format and then store them in our database. The four BLOB types are TINYBLOB, BLOB, MEDIUMBLOB, and LONGBLOB. These differ only in the maximum length of the values they can hold.
